A Dinosaur Emerges...
Next to my black & white TV and folder of daguerreotypes, I have a computer running OOTP2. Yes, OOTP2.
Don't laugh... here's why: I'm on a Mac. I'm running Virtual PC to emulate Windows. As far as I know, OOTP2 was the latest version to work on Virtual PC. Well, I'm very interested in moving my league to the latest and greatest if it is at all possible. Can you guys let me know if this is indeed possible? Would I have to move the league through every version (3 to 4 to 5 to 6 to 2006)? Will this even work? I understand I'll lose a lot of league history, but that's cool. We have a pretty good archive of our own on our site... of course, all handmade because of the lack of extra tools for OOTP2. So, please... lemme know. I may be able to solicit guys in my league that have each version so we could go step by step. Thanks!
